namespace openscreen {
namespace cast {
struct ServiceInfo;
class VirtualConnectionRouter;
// This class handles Cast messages that generally relate to the "platform", in
// other words not a specific app currently running (e.g. app availability,
// receiver status). These messages follow a request/response format, so each
// request requires a corresponding response callback. These requests will also
// timeout if there is no response after a certain amount of time (currently 5
// seconds). The timeout callbacks will be called on the thread managed by
// |task_runner|.
class CastPlatformClient final : public CastMessageHandler {
public:
using AppAvailabilityCallback =
std::function<void(const std::string& app_id, AppAvailabilityResult)>;
CastPlatformClient(VirtualConnectionRouter* router,
ClockNowFunctionPtr clock,
TaskRunner* task_runner);
~CastPlatformClient() override;
// Requests availability information for |app_id| from the receiver identified
// by |device_id|. |callback| will be called exactly once with a result.
absl::optional<int> RequestAppAvailability(const std::string& device_id,
const std::string& app_id,
AppAvailabilityCallback callback);
// Notifies this object about general receiver connectivity or property
// changes.
void AddOrUpdateReceiver(const ServiceInfo& device, int socket_id);
void RemoveReceiver(const ServiceInfo& device);
void CancelRequest(int request_id);
private:
struct AvailabilityRequest {
int request_id;
std::string app_id;
std::unique_ptr<Alarm> timeout;
AppAvailabilityCallback callback;
};
struct PendingRequests {
std::vector<AvailabilityRequest> availability;
};
// CastMessageHandler overrides.
void OnMessage(VirtualConnectionRouter* router,
CastSocket* socket,
::cast::channel::CastMessage message) override;
void HandleResponse(const std::string& device_id,
int request_id,
const Json::Value& message);
void CancelAppAvailabilityRequest(int request_id);
static int GetNextRequestId();
static int next_request_id_;
const std::string sender_id_;
VirtualConnectionRouter* const virtual_conn_router_;
std::map<std::string /* device_id */, int> socket_id_by_device_id_;
std::map<std::string /* device_id */, PendingRequests>
pending_requests_by_device_id_;
const ClockNowFunctionPtr clock_;
TaskRunner* const task_runner_;
};
} // namespace cast
} // namespace openscreen
